EHS Manager
Siemens Energy is a leading energy technology company with a commitment to sustainable and reliable energy solutions. The EHS Manager will coordinate health and safety functions, ensure regulatory compliance, and develop EH&S programs to support plant operations.

Responsibilities
Assists in the development and implementation of corporate and plant EH&S programs
Provides technical support to plant personnel on all EH&S matters
Assists with plant requests, i.e., assistance in identifying safety equipment, federal, state and local regulations; procedure reviews and revisions or development; training material and/or instructor costs; review required documentation records for accuracy and filing of documents and reporting
Assists in self-auditing of plant sites and follow-up of action items
Tracks federal and state EH&S regulations
Develops and implements EH&S policies
Develops, reviews and revises, as necessary, all plant EH&S procedures for consistency
Reviews site activities for liability assessment
Manages the site security function
Coordinates the safety training function at the plant
Other duties as assigned
Following all safety/environmental policies, procedures, rules, and participating in training. Promoting the company's highest value, HS&E, through actions and conduct
Following all company policies and expectations and behaving in a manner that promotes the company's values and positively effects morale
Coaches site employees on safety, as needed, and counsels or issues discipline, as necessary
Coordinates reporting of statistics or incidents to corporate and governmental organizations
Liaison for workers compensation claims
Advises management team on safety issues, violations, provides input on employee evaluations, and makes recommendations
Qualification
Required
Five to ten years experience in safety and environmental specialist role, ideally in a power or power-related business
Bachelors degree or equivalent experience in environmental, safety engineering, industrial safety or industrial hygiene
Familiar with federal MSHA and OSHA statutes
Strong verbal and written communication skills for effectively communicating inside the organization and with outside agencies
Ability to analyze technical and regulatory information, make sound judgments and provide prudent recommendations to all levels of the company
Strong team and leadership skills
Advanced skill in operating Microsoft Word 6.0, Power point, Excel, Microsoft Project, DAHS systems and other information transmission equipment
Must be able to read, write, speak, and understand English
Ability to handle confidential and sensitive information
Qualified Applicants must be legally authorized for employment in the United States and will not require employer sponsored work authorization now or in the future for employment
Ability to work at heights, in confined areas and to travel by air
Sufficient pulmonary function and facial seal to wear respirators, as required
